ISIS EXECUTED 300 SECURITY, ACTIVIST AND CIVILIAN IN MOSUL : IRAQ PMF SAYS


On Sunday, al-Hashd al-Shaabi (Popular Mobilization Forces) media official Mahmoud al-Sourji announced, that the so-called "Islamic state" terrorist group executed more than 300 persons in Mosul, while pointed out that the executed people were police and army personnel, as well as civil activists.

Sourji said in a brief statement, “ISIS executed more than 300 police and army personnel, in addition to civil activists by firing squad in Mosul”, IraqiNews reported.

Mosul is suffering from major security and humanitarian crisis due to ISIS control on the city.
